collapse expand iconDescription

The XVive U4R4 In-Ear monitor wireless system provides musicians and audio professionals with cutting-edge wireless monitoring. Its transmitter sends 24-bit/48kHz audio to four receivers, each powering a pair of in-ear monitors for pristine, interference-free sound. With a frequency range of 20Hz to 20kHz, the U4R4 delivers audio quality exceeding CD standards for nuanced monitoring during recording, rehearsing or performing.

Hear Every Note With High-Resolution Audio

The U4R4's 24-bit/48kHz audio and wide 20Hz to 20kHz frequency range mean you'll experience your mix with exceptional clarity and detail. Its signal-to-noise ratio of over 107dB ensures a quiet background and minimal distortion for accurate monitoring. Whether you're tracking vocals, dialing in a guitar tone or hearing every element of your band's live show, the U4R4 lets you monitor with confidence.

Cut the Cord for Recording and Practice

For home recording, the U4R4 provides the freedom to move around your studio space unencumbered by cables. Lay down tracks, check mixes and tweak levels from anywhere in the room. The U4R4 is also ideal for private practice, letting you rehearse unplugged with your entire band or alone whenever inspiration strikes. Its discreet in-ear design means you can practice day or night without disturbing others.

Up to Five Hours of Battery Life per Charge

The U4R4's rechargeable batteries provide up to five hours of continuous use per charge for reliability during recording sessions, rehearsals and performances. Their USB charging lets you power up from any standard charger, computer or portable charger for added convenience. With a quick charge time of 1.5 to 2.5 hours, you'll be back to enjoying wireless freedom in no time.

Group Monitoring Made Simple

The U4R4's transmitter sends its high-definition signal to four receivers at once, allowing you to set up group monitoring for your entire band during rehearsals or provide multiple listening stations in a studio environment. Each receiver powers a pair of in-ear monitors so up to eight people can experience your mix simultaneously with no signal degradation.

collapse expand iconFeatures

  • High-quality, ultracompact wireless system for in-ear monitors
  • Audiophile 24-bit/48kHz sound with less than 5 ms of latency
  • Industry standard 2.4gHz wireless technology
  • Reliable, solid RF connection over a range of 90 feet
  • Can also wirelessly broadcast to an audio recorder or mixer
  • Less than 5ms latency
  • 5 hours of battery life
  • Create your personal or team/band monitor system
  • Includes one transmitter with four receivers
